Job Description
The Agnes Irwin School, a pre-K through 12 all girls’ school in Rosemont, PA seeks a
Middle School Varsity Lacrosse Coach, beginning March 4, 2024, and ending May 20,
2024. This position will be responsible for developing the Middle School lacrosse program
and student-athletes under the direction of the Athletic Director, and teaching skills and
strategies that apply to the skill level of the student-athletes.
Successful candidates will possess:
● Bachelor’s degree or equivalent combination of education and related
experience
● Experience teaching or coaching lacrosse; previous competitive lacrosse
playing/coaching required
● Proven ability to exemplify the highest standard of leadership, sportsmanship,
and respect
● Knowledge of appropriate safety measures to ensure the well-being of
student-athletes
● Excellent communication and organizational skills with the ability to effectively
manage relationships with administrators, student-athletes, and parents
● Ability to attend all team practices and games
● PA Child Abuse History Certification, PA State Criminal Record Check, and FBI
Fingerprints are required and must be less than one year old
● Must possess or obtain prior to start of season current First Aid and CPR
certification
